白璐 博士,教授,博士生导师,国家优青,国家优秀自费留学生奖,龙马学者青年学者

基本资料:

白璐,男,副教授,博士生导师,国家优秀青年科学基金获得者(国家优青),国家优秀自费留学生奖学金获得者(教育部批准,2014年度全球500人,英国使馆区35人),彩乐仑彩票首批“龙马学者青年学者”。2015年1月于英国约克大学(University of York, UK)取得博士学位,导师Edwin R. Hancock教授(IEEE/IAPR Fellow, IAPR前副主席)。于澳门科技大学(Macau University of Science and Technology, Macau SAR, China)分别获理学学士(优秀毕业论文)、理学硕士学位。现任职于彩乐仑彩票计算机系、国家金融安全教育部工程研究中心。主要研究方向为:基于图的模式识别、机器学习、量子游走、金融数据分析。主持国家自然科学基金优秀青年、面上、青年项目3项,模式识别国家重点实验室开放课题项目1项(结题评优),彩乐仑彩票第四批青年科研创新团队项目与标志性科研成果预培项目2项。发表国际权威期刊会议论文近90篇(CCF/CAA推荐近60篇,IAPR旗下会议20余篇),其中代表性第一/通讯作者国际顶级期刊、会议TPAMITKDETNNLSTCYBPRICMLIJCAIECML-PKDDICDM论文22篇(CCF/CAA推荐A19篇)部分研究成果已应用于科大讯飞、中国电信等知名企业实际业务。担任国际模式识别期刊Pattern Recognition副主编(Associate Editor),并作为责任客座编辑(Managing Guest Editor)于该期刊组织该期刊首个基于图方法的金融大数据分析特刊,担任IJCAI 2020 Session Chair (FinTech Track)ICPR 2018 Session Chair。曾获三项国际会议最佳/优秀论文奖(ICIAP 2015ICPR 2018IEEM 2019),以及国际模式识别学会IAPR Newsletter下一代(The Next Generation)专栏报道。 指导本科/硕士生多人获校级优秀毕业论文、北京市优秀毕业生,指导学生以第一或主要作者发表国际顶级或重要期刊会议论文多篇。
